Tea recipe · Fennel, Licorice & Verveine

The Standard Cup (Yogi Tea Organic Throat Comfort)

Prep6 min YieldMakes 1 mug DifficultyEasy

Yogi Tea Organic Throat Comfort is a warming sweet-and-spice Ayurvedic-style blend of liquorice, slippery elm, cinnamon and ginger. Brewed five minutes, it gives a caffeine-free, smooth cup with the deep flavour of liquorice and a gentle warming spice. The liquorice means it needs no sugar.

You'll need

  • 1 tea bag of Yogi Tea Organic Throat Comfort
  • 250ml freshly boiled water (100C)
  • A slice of lemon, optional
  • A little extra honey, optional

Method

  1. Pop the tea bag in your favourite mug.
  2. Pour over the freshly boiled water and leave to steep for 5 minutes so the liquorice and spices come through.
  3. Lift out the bag without squeezing it.
  4. There is no need for sugar, as the liquorice is naturally sweet, but a slice of lemon lifts it nicely.
  5. Sip warm and enjoy a smooth, naturally sweet cup.
  6. The slippery elm gives the cup a slightly silky body; drink it while hot for the best texture.
What you'll end up with: A smooth, caffeine-free cup, deep with liquorice and warmed by cinnamon and ginger, sweet without any sugar.
